Description

When a 1/2-inch hose reel needs to work without any power source no shop air, no electrical circuit, no hydraulic connection and manual retraction of 100 feet of hose needs to be manageable by a single operator, the Coxreels 1125-4-100-C delivers it. The front bevel geared crank (a mechanism using angled gears to redirect the operator's cranking force into drum rotation, reducing the effort required to wind 100 feet of 1/2-inch hose back onto the drum by hand) gives controlled, smooth retraction with a removable handle that stores out of the way when the hose is deployed. A long-handled locking pin locks the drum solid during storage, transport, or any fixed-extension use. Built on the same all-welded 12-gauge steel A-frame, CNC-spun ribbed discs, and machined solid brass 90° NPT swivel as the rest of the 1125 Series, the 1125-4-100-C handles 3,000 PSI working pressure for air, water, or oil service entirely under the operator's control, with no external power required. For installations where running an air line or electrical circuit to the reel isn't practical, or where the simplicity and reliability of a mechanical-only retraction system is preferred, this is the 1125 Series answer.

FAQs

Q: Why is the bevel geared crank only available on the 1125 Series and not on 1-inch hose reels?
A: The bevel geared crank (-C suffix) is available on the 1125 Series for hose up to 3/4-inch ID. For 1-inch ID hose, the drum load is too heavy for practical hand-crank operation, so Coxreels uses the larger 1175 Series chassis with a bevel geared crank designed specifically for that heavier drum capacity. If you need a crank-rewind reel for 1-inch hose at 100 feet or longer, the 1175-6 series with the -C suffix is the appropriate product.

Q: What is the difference between the bevel geared crank ("-C") and a standard direct hand crank on the 1125 Series?
A: The standard direct hand crank (no suffix, or the base hand crank model) connects the crank handle directly to the drum axle one handle rotation equals one drum rotation with no mechanical advantage. The bevel geared crank uses angled gears to change the direction of rotation and provide a gear ratio that reduces the force required per turn, making it easier to wind a fully loaded 100-foot drum without the arm fatigue of a direct crank. For longer hose lengths and heavier loads, the bevel gear is the more practical choice.

Q: Does the reel come with hose included?
A: No the 1125-4-100-C ships less hose. The drum accepts 1/2" ID / 7/8" OD hose up to 100 feet. Select hose rated for your working pressure and media (air, water, oil, or other compatible fluids at up to 3,000 PSI) and install it on the drum before use.

Q: Can the crank handle be removed while the hose is under pressure?
A: The handle is designed to be removable for storage and deployment convenience, but it should not be removed while the reel is under pressure. Removing the handle while the hose carries pressurized fluid opens the flow path and can create a hazardous condition. Always depressurize the hose line before removing the crank handle.

Q: Can this reel handle fluids other than air?
A: Yes models supplied less hose can be used for air, water, or oil service at up to 3,000 PSI. The machined brass swivel and Nitrile seals are compatible with petroleum-based oils and water but have limited resistance to some synthetic hydraulic fluids and solvents. Confirm seal and swivel material compatibility with your specific fluid before installation.
